CORNUDELLA DE MONTSANT

Region : Catalonia
Province : Tarragona

Escudo de Cornudella de Montsant/Arms (crest) of Cornudella de Montsant
Official blazon
Catalan Escut caironat: d'or, un cor de gules; el cap de sable. Per timbre una corona mural de vila.
English de Montsant No blazon/translation known. Please click here to send your (heraldic !) blazon or translation

Origin/meaning

The arms were granted on December 17, 1984.

Canting arms: they show a "cor" (Catalan for "heart"). The colours, gold and a sable top, are taken from the arms of Entença family, because the town was a part of the barony of Entença in the 13th century.
